#include <stdio.h>
void erro (int assinante){
if (assinante != 1 && assinante != 2)
printf("Dados do assinante incorretos. \n");
}
void assinante1(int assinante, int qtdpulso, int qtddesper ){
if (assinante==1){
float mensalidade=36.00;
float vlrdespertador = qtddesper*10.00;
if (qtdpulso<=50){
float vlrconta= mensalidade+vlrdespertador;
printf ("Valor da Conta: %f \n",vlrconta);
}
else{
float vlrpulsoexcedente=(qtdpulso-50)*0.99;
float vlrconta = mensalidade+vlrdespertador+vlrpulsoexcedente;
printf ("Valor da Conta: %f \n" ,vlrconta);
}
}
}
int main (){
char nome [10],numero[10];
int assinante, despertador,qtdpulso,qtddesper;
float mensalidade;
printf("Digite seu nome \n \n");
scanf("%s",&nome);
printf("Digite o numero do telefone \n \n");
scanf("%s",&numero);
printf("Digite a quantidade de pulsos utilizados no mês \n\n");
scanf ("%d",&qtdpulso);
printf ("Informe a quantidade de veses que foi utilizado o serviço de despertador \n\n");
scanf ("%d",&qtddesper);
printf("Digite 1 para Assinante Residencial e 2 para Assinante Comercial \n\n");
scanf("%d",&assinante);
erro(assinante);
assinante1(assinante,qtdpulso,qtddesper);
system("pause");
return(0);
}
Nenhum comentário:
Postar um comentário